Utilizing AI and Machine Learning in Retail Customer Feedback Analysis

Retailers today face the challenge of managing vast amounts of customer feedback data. This data often comes from various channels like surveys, social media, or online reviews. Utilizing AI and machine learning techniques enables retailers to analyze this wealth of feedback effectively. These technologies can identify patterns and trends that would be nearly impossible to discern manually. By implementing sentiment analysis, retailers can categorize feedback into positive, negative, or neutral sentiments. This can provide a clearer picture of how customers perceive products and services. Furthermore, AI-driven models can predict future customer behavior based on historical data. Insights gained from this analysis empower businesses to make informed decisions to enhance customer experience. Integrating these techniques can ultimately improve product offerings, service delivery, and customer satisfaction rates. Retailers that harness the power of AI in their feedback systems can better adapt to changing market demands and customer preferences. This adaptability is crucial for staying competitive in today’s fast-paced retail environment, where customer expectations are continuously evolving.

Challenges in Implementing AI Systems

While AI provides robust capabilities for analyzing customer feedback, several challenges exist in implementing these systems. The primary hurdle is the quality of input data; inaccurate or inconsistent data can lead to flawed conclusions. Retailers must dedicate resources to cleanse and maintain their databases regularly. Moreover, understanding and interpreting AI-generated insights can be another challenge, particularly for smaller businesses lacking data expertise. Training staff to utilize these insights effectively is essential for maximizing the benefits of AI. Adopting AI systems also requires a cultural shift within the organization, emphasizing the importance of data-driven decision-making. Integrating AI technologies into existing systems can lead to compatibility issues, requiring technological upgrades. Retailers should assess their infrastructure readiness before pursuing AI solutions. Additionally, ethical considerations regarding data privacy must be addressed to maintain customer trust. Transparent data practices help mitigate concerns over how customer information is utilized. By recognizing potential challenges early on, retailers can take proactive measures to overcome them and successfully implement AI-driven feedback systems.
